The Gulangyu Inn's Haunted Honeymoon: A Video That Brought Love to the Dead
The sun dipped below the horizon, casting a golden hue over the serene waters of Gulangyu Island. The Gulangyu Inn, nestled among the lush greenery, was a place of whispered legends and hidden secrets. It was here that the young couple, Emily and Alex, decided to embark on their honeymoon, seeking a romantic getaway away from the hustle and bustle of the city.
As they stepped into the inn, the air was thick with anticipation. The manager, an elderly man with a twinkle in his eye, greeted them warmly. "Welcome to the Gulangyu Inn," he said, his voice tinged with a hint of mystery. "Many have found love here, but some have also found their pasts catching up with them."
The couple's room was quaint and cozy, with a large, ornate mirror that dominated one wall. They spent their first night exploring the island, their laughter mingling with the sound of waves crashing against the shore. But as the night wore on, Emily felt an inexplicable chill. She couldn't shake the feeling that they were being watched.
The next morning, Alex found a peculiar video in the room. It was an old, grainy recording of a wedding, set in the same inn. The bride and groom were young and in love, their faces filled with joy. But as the video progressed, a sense of dread settled over Alex. The groom, a man named David, was being chased by a shadowy figure. The groom's cries for help grew louder, and then, suddenly, the video ended.
Emily and Alex were shaken. They couldn't shake the feeling that they were connected to this mysterious past. They decided to investigate, hoping to uncover the truth behind the video. They returned to the inn, where the manager, now looking more concerned than ever, revealed that the groom, David, had been a guest at the inn many years ago. He had fallen in love with a woman named Lily, who was also staying at the inn. But tragedy struck when Lily was killed in a fire, leaving David heartbroken and alone.
The couple's curiosity led them to Lily's grave, where they found a locket containing a photograph of Lily and David. The photograph was dated the same day as the wedding in the video. The realization that they were related to these two lovers hit them hard. Emily and Alex felt an overwhelming sense of responsibility to uncover the truth.
As they delved deeper into the story, they discovered that David had never truly moved on from Lily's death. He had become a ghost, trapped in the inn, searching for his lost love. The couple's presence seemed to have triggered something in David, as he began to appear to them, his eyes filled with sorrow and longing.
One night, as they sat by the inn's fireplace, David revealed his story. "I loved Lily with all my heart," he said, his voice trembling. "But when she died, I couldn't bear to live without her. I've been searching for her, hoping that she might still be out there, waiting for me."
Emily and Alex listened, their hearts aching for the man they had come to care for. They realized that they had the power to help David find peace. They decided to create a video of their own, a message for David to know that he was not alone and that his love for Lily would never fade.
The night they filmed the video, the inn was filled with an eerie silence. Emily and Alex stood in front of the ornate mirror, their faces reflecting the glow of the fireplace. They spoke directly to David, their voices filled with emotion.
"We know you're out there, David," Emily said. "We see you, and we hear you. We want you to know that love is eternal, and that Lily would want you to find peace. We promise to keep her memory alive, and to help you find the peace you deserve."
As they finished filming, they felt a sense of release. The next morning, as they left the inn, they knew that they had made a difference. David had found the peace he had been searching for, and with it, the couple had found a new purpose in their lives.
The Gulangyu Inn's Haunted Honeymoon had brought love to the dead, and in doing so, had given Emily and Alex a profound connection to the past. They left the island with a heart full of gratitude, knowing that they had played a part in a story that would live on forever.
